Burial of pet animals
Your pet has died or had to be put down due to an incurable illness or an accident.
-
Basic information
It is not permitted to bury pets on your own property in the state of Bremen. Pet owners can have their deceased pets collected for a fee or hand them in at one of the three animal carcass collection points. There is also the option of burial at one of Bremen's animal cemeteries.
